"Generally good, but I didn't taste the food because I was concentrating and preparing for the match. But I think it is good because we were provided by a comfortable seat, massage device and cool room temperature," Jan O Jorgensen, a Danish men's singles player, said.
"Generally, it is comfortable enough although many complained about hot warming up hall, but I think it was not a big deal, it can be for our warming up," Jorgensen said.
Compliments are also coming from one of the Japan's women's doubles, Ayaka Takahashi. She said the Player Lounge Istora is cozy enough and it has many kinds of food. At the Player Lounge, the athletes could enjoy wifi connection and tv set to watch live matches.
